Juli 2006 17:56 schrieb Andrew Morton: > > Begin forwarded message: > > Date: Wed, 12 Jul 2006 02:40:10 -0700 > From: [EMAIL PROTECTED] > To: [EMAIL PROTECTED] > Subject: [Bugme-new] [Bug 6823] New: Zyxel Uno USB modem broken by David > Kubicek's patch in 2.6.16 > > > http://bugzilla.kernel.org/show_bug.cgi?id=6823 > > Summary: Zyxel Uno USB modem broken by David Kubicek's patch in > 2.6.16 > Kernel Version: 2.6.16 > Status: NEW > Severity: normal > Owner: [EMAIL PROTECTED] > Submitter: [EMAIL PROTECTED] > > > Most recent kernel where this bug did not occur: 2.6.17 > Distribution: Arch Linux > Hardware Environment: x86_64 and x86 > Software Environment: pppd, chat, cdc-acm driver > Problem Description: > Modem duplicates incoming characters. > For example session log: > ATTTDT554404 > COCONNNNECT
Hi, there seems to be a buggy firmware out there that causes such reduplications. Please send me the output of "lsusb -v" with your modem plugged in. It needs to be put in the list of special cases.
